The website lasportivafun.com appears to be a scam. Here are the reasons: 1. Newly Registered Domain: The domain was registered very recently, which is often a red flag for fraudulent websites. Scammers frequently create new domains to avoid being identified. 2. Lack of Online Presence: The website does not have a significant online presence or customer reviews, which is unusual for a legitimate e-commerce site. 3. Unrealistic Discounts: The significant discounts on brand-name products, such as shoes and handbags, are often a tactic used by scam websites to lure in unsuspecting customers. 4. Poor Website Design: The website's design and layout appear unprofessional, with a lack of detailed product information and a focus on discounted prices. 5. Limited Product Range: The site seems to offer a limited range of products, which is uncommon for a legitimate e-commerce store. 6. Lack of Contact Information: Legitimate e-commerce websites typically provide clear and verifiable contact information, including a physical address and customer service phone number. This website may lack such information. 7. Suspicious Payment Methods: Be cautious if the website only accepts less secure payment methods or if the payment process seems unusual or unsecure. 8. Check for HTTPS and Secure Payment: Ensure that the website uses HTTPS and a secure payment gateway to protect your personal and financial information. 9. Research the Company: Look for independent reviews and information about the company outside of their own website to verify their legitimacy. 10. Trust Your Instincts: If something feels off or too good to be true, it's better to err on the side of caution and avoid making a purchase. It's important to be extremely cautious when dealing with unfamiliar online stores, especially those that exhibit multiple red flags like the ones mentioned above. Always prioritize the security of your personal and financial information, and consider making purchases from well-established and reputable e-commerce platforms."
